Betti Stradling Park

Coral Springs · NW Broward

The dedicated tot lot means no dodging older kids, and mature trees plus shade sails keep it playable later into the morning.

Plantation Heritage Park

Plantation · Central Broward

Real shade from mature trees (rare!), ducks to point at, and enough space that even a busy Saturday doesn't feel packed.

Park$

Tree Tops Park

Davie · Central Broward

The tree canopy makes it several degrees cooler than open parks, and the boardwalk adds a mini 'hike' toddlers can actually finish.

Park$

Vista View Park

Davie · Central Broward

Rolling down grassy hills plus a free splash pad to cool off after — a full morning of entertainment with a built-in reset button.

Sugar Sand Park & Children's Science Explorium

Boca Raton · South Palm Beach

Arguably the best playground in South Florida, with an indoor science room and $1-ish carousel rides to reset a hot afternoon.
